Job Description

Business Area Wind (BA Wind) is responsible for Vattenfalls Onshore and Offshore Wind as well as Solar PV and Batteries. Today we develop construct and operate wind and Solar and hybrid farms in Sweden Denmark Germany the Netherlands and the UK.

Join our Batteries team within BA Wind dedicated to developing and integrating battery storage systems into wind and especially solar farms. Our mission is to enhance renewable energy projects driving us closer to a fossilfree future. We thrive on team spirit flexibility and an open inclusive atmosphere. If youre passionate about renewable energy and eager to contribute to a dynamic and growing business this might be your new challenge.

As Project Manager integrated Batteries you will play a crucial role in realizing battery storage systems in our solar development portfolio. Your responsibilities will span from feasibility assessments to commissioning and handover. You will work in a selforganized team applying holocracy ensuring collaborative efforts internally with the solar development team and externally with grid operators and other stakeholders.

Your tasks and responsibilities

  • Project Development: Drive the development and delivery of projects through internal and external milestones ensuring timely approvals and material readiness.
  • Project Management: Oversee project scope time cost quality and risk management ensuring alignment with project sponsor agreements.
  • Resource Allocation: Specify and manage the required resources including human resources equipment and tools.
  • Team Coordination: Plan delegate and organize work packages and project teams for construction and commissioning phases.
  • Stakeholder Management: Maintain strong relationships with internal departments and external stakeholders such as municipalities landowners and grid operators.
  • Safety Promotion: Foster a culture of safety energy motivation and entrepreneurship within the team.
  • Risk Reporting: Proactively identify and report potential deviations from agreed plans.
  • Contract Negotiation: Negotiate terms with landowners and external stakeholders in coordination with our legal team.
  • OnSite Coordination: Manage contractors and onsite project coordination with a focus on safe and efficient project delivery.

Locations: Hamburg or Berlin 


Qualifications :

Your profile

  • Experience: Proven experience in project management and/or engineering preferably within renewable asset projects or large scale Batteries.
  • Education: Academic degree in business civil engineering or a related field.
  • Skills:
    • Project management expertise including organization resource management leadership project economics and time management.
    • Ability to navigate and adapt to various environments including political stakeholders and business partners.
    • Strong problemsolving and resultoriented mindset with team player capabilities.
    • Excellent communication skills particularly in report writing and presenting complex technical issues clearly.
    • Fluency in English both written and verbal. German language skills are a plus.
